Which is better AutoCAD or SketchUp?
Determining which software is better between AutoCAD and SketchUp depends largely on the specific needs, preferences, and expertise of the user. Each program has its strengths and is designed to serve different functions within the realm of design and drafting.
AutoCAD is a highly versatile and powerful software that is well-established in the fields of architecture, engineering, and construction. It is known for its precision and advanced features that are essential for creating detailed 2D drawings and complex 3D models. Here are some key aspects of AutoCAD:
- Precision: AutoCAD is designed to produce precise technical drawings, where accuracy is paramount.
- Functionality: It offers a wide range of tools for drafting, annotation, and design modification.
- Compatibility: AutoCAD files are widely accepted as a standard in many industries, making it easy to share and collaborate.
- Customization: Users can customize the interface and use programing languages like AutoLISP and Visual Basic for Applications (VBA) to automate tasks.
SketchUp, on the other hand, is known for its user-friendly interface and ease of use, making it a popular choice for beginners and professionals who want to quickly mock up 3D models and architectural designs. Here are some of SketchUp's features:
- Intuitive Design: SketchUp has a simple interface that is easy to learn, making it accessible for beginners and hobbyists.
- 3D Modeling: It is primarily used for 3D modeling, especially in architecture, interior design, and woodworking.
- Speed: With SketchUp, users can quickly create and visualize 3D spaces.
- Extensions: A vast library of plugins and extensions is available to enhance SketchUp’s functionality.
In conclusion, if you require software for highly technical and precise drawings with industry-standard compatibility, AutoCAD is likely the better choice. If your focus is on ease of use, quick 3D modeling, and a more intuitive learning curve, SketchUp may be more suitable. Ultimately, the decision should be based on the specific requirements of the project and the user’s familiarity with the software.

What are the disadvantages of using SketchUp?
What are the disadvantages of using SketchUp?
While SketchUp is a popular and user-friendly 3D modeling tool used by professionals and hobbyists alike, it does come with certain limitations and drawbacks. Here are some of the disadvantages associated with using SketchUp:
- Limited Rendering Capabilities: SketchUp's built-in rendering engine is not as powerful as those found in more specialized software. This can result in less realistic images and may require additional plugins or external rendering programs for high-quality visuals.
- Less Precision for Complex Modeling: SketchUp is known for its ease of use, but this can sometimes come at the cost of precision, especially when working on complex or highly detailed models.
- Performance Issues with Large Files: As the size of the 3D model grows, SketchUp users may experience slowdowns or crashes. This is particularly true for models with a large number of components or high-resolution textures.
- Compatibility and Interoperability: While SketchUp can import and export various file formats, there could be issues with compatibility when transferring models to other professional CAD applications, potentially leading to data loss or additional work to fix discrepancies.
- Tools and Features: Compared to other professional CAD and 3D modeling software, SketchUp may lack advanced tools and features that are necessary for more specialized tasks in industries like engineering or architecture.
- Learning Curve for Advanced Features: Although SketchUp is easy to learn for beginners, mastering its more advanced features and functions can take a significant amount of time and effort.
- Cost of Pro Version: While there is a free version of SketchUp, it lacks many features that are only available in the paid Pro version. This cost can be a barrier for some users or small businesses.
- Dependence on Plugins: To overcome some of its limitations, SketchUp often relies on third-party plugins. However, these can vary in quality, and managing them can become cumbersome.
- No Native Support for Parametric Modeling: SketchUp does not natively support parametric modeling, which is a key feature for many CAD users who need to make frequent and precise modifications to their designs.
- Subpar Documentation and Support: Some users find that SketchUp's documentation is not as comprehensive as it could be, and the support for troubleshooting technical issues may not be as robust compared to other software providers.
In summary, while SketchUp has its advantages, such as ease of use and a large community, these disadvantages should be considered when choosing it for more complex or professional 3D modeling projects.

Autocad or sketchup for interior design
AutoCAD for Interior Design
AutoCAD is a powerful design and drafting software developed by Autodesk. It is widely used in various fields, including interior design, for creating detailed 2D drawings and complex 3D models. Here are some key points about AutoCAD in the context of interior design:
1. Precision: AutoCAD allows designers to draw with precision to the smallest of measurements. This is crucial for creating accurate floor plans, elevations, and sections.
2. Customization: Users can create custom blocks and templates, which can be reused in different projects, saving time and maintaining consistency.
3. Layer Management: AutoCAD's layer management system helps in organizing various elements of the design, making it easier to navigate through complex drawings.
4. Compatibility: The software is compatible with numerous other tools and file formats, facilitating easy collaboration and data sharing.
SketchUp for Interior Design
SketchUp, on the other hand, is renowned for its user-friendly interface and is considered to be more approachable for beginners. Here's how SketchUp stands out in interior design:
1. 3D Modeling: SketchUp is primarily a 3D modeling tool, which allows designers to visualize spaces and furniture arrangements in three dimensions.
2. Speed: It is known for its quick modeling capabilities, enabling designers to create concepts in a relatively short amount of time.
3. Extensive Library: The software offers access to a vast library of pre-made models and materials in the 3D Warehouse, which can be a huge time-saver.
4. Interactive Presentations: With SketchUp, designers can create walkthroughs and animations, which are excellent for presenting ideas to clients.
Choosing Between AutoCAD and SketchUp
The choice between AutoCAD and SketchUp often comes down to the specific needs of the project and the designer's personal preference.
- For projects that require detailed technical drawings and a high degree of precision, AutoCAD is typically the preferred choice.
- If the focus is on quick conceptual work, with an emphasis on 3D visualization and client presentations, SketchUp may be more suitable.
Many professionals in the industry use both, taking advantage of the strengths of each software. AutoCAD's detailed plan work can be complemented by SketchUp's 3D visualizations, offering a comprehensive package for interior design projects.
